[Précédent (date)] [Suivant (date)] [Précédent (sujet)] [Suivant (sujet)] [Index par date] [Index par sujet]

RE: Sendmail



Pourquoi ne pas tout simplement mettre le smtp du provider au lieu de celui 
du serveur?
Moi c'est ce que je fais smtp= relais.videotron.ca et il y a aucun probleme 
a envoyer du courrier n'importe ou. Par contre le courrier destine a 
l'interne doit aussi passer par le net avant de revenir sur le serveur.

-----Message d'origine-----
De:     Hugo Villeneuve [SMTP:[email protected]]
Date:   3 fevrier, 2000 23:31
A:      [email protected]
Objet:  Re: Sendmail

[email protected] wrote:
>
> Pour permettre a mes stations de mon reseau d'envoyer
> du courrier a l'exterieur du domaine, j'ai place,
> dans le fichier sendmail.mc, la ligne suivante
>
>    feature('relay_entire_domaine')
>
> puis, j'ai compile avec la commande
>     m4 /etc/sendmail.mc > /etc/sendmail.cf
>
> Mes stations ne sont toujours pas en mesure d'envoyer du
> courrier a l'exterieur.
>
> Any clue ?
>
> Merci beaucoup

Bonne feature sauf que c'est relay "QUEL??" entire domaine. Quel domaine
sendmail utilise et utilises-tu un mecanisme de resolution de nom de
domaine sur ton reseau (genre DNS avec reverse mapping ou /etc/hosts
complet)?

Je connais deja les reponses que tu vas me faire: 1. je sais pas.  2.
non.

# sendmail -bt -d0.1

Va te donner les informations sur l'identite qu'utilise sendmail.

Solution:
1. Essaye d'ajouter "192.168.10." a /etc/mail/relay-domains pour voir si
ca marche. (kill -HUP sendmail) (Ca risque de ne pas marcher)

2. Utilise l'access db.

FEATURE(access_db)dnl

ne pas avoir FEATURE(relay_hosts_only) en meme temps je crois (test
sinon)

Cree ce fichier avec ce contenu:
/etc/mail/access :
192.168.10.     RELAY

Cree la database
# makemap hash /etc/mail/access </etc/mail/access


http://www.sendmail.org/tips/relaying.html


Hugo